When Should You Consult a Psychiatrist?

You should consider consulting a psychiatrist if you experience:

  • Persistent sadness, anxiety, or mood swings
  • Difficulty sleeping or excessive stress
  • Panic attacks or constant fear
  • Trouble concentrating or managing daily activities
  • Behavioral changes or emotional instability
  • Addiction-related concerns or substance dependence

Early intervention can help manage symptoms effectively and improve emotional and mental well-being.

How to reduce adrenaline anxiety?

The inner glands produce adrenaline. Adrenaline is also known as the “fight-or-flight hormone.” It's released in response to a stressful, exciting, dangerous, or threatening situation. Adrenaline helps your body react more quickly. One can reduce adrenaline by activating relaxation response ( in contrast of fight and flight response) by doing meditation, yoga, playing a sport, listening to music ect. One can do relaxation exercises like Jacobsons progressive muscular relaxation, pranayam and through guided imagery.

I take Sertraline for anxiety and depression and I am going to have my first tattoo done and don't no if the Sertraline has blood thinners in it. Many Thanks.

Male | 47

Sertraline is a medicine often used for anxiety and depression. Tattooing does not contain blood thinners but may result in minor bleeding. Thus it’s important to inform the tattoo artist about your intake of Sertraline so that they can take necessary precautions. To prevent any complications ensure you adhere to their aftercare advice.
